My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

I'm Chapssal, a 10-month-old male Jindo mix eagerly searching for my forever home. I may be a bit shy around new people, but once you offer me some tasty treats, I warm up quickly. I love being petted, cuddled, and I'll even show off some charming antics once we become friends.

I currently share my temporary home with other furry companion, and I tend to rely on dogs with me for comfort. I believe a household with other dogs would make me feel even more secure. When left alone, I might express my anxiety with some whimpering, so a family that understands separation anxiety would be perfect for me.

I'm great at focusing during walks and will happily trot alongside you. However, I get a bit frightened when other dogs approach, and busy streets with noisy cars are still a little overwhelming for me. I'm learning, though! Being a young pup, I have loads of energy. After a good walk, I love to relax and recharge.

While I won't guard my food from humans, I do growl if other dogs come too close. Meeting strangers might make me bark initially, but I'm well-behaved when it comes to indoor and outdoor potty habits. Oh, and did I mention I have a scar on one of my legs? It's a little reminder of my journey.

Additional adoption info

Most of our dogs are currently in Korea. After we give approvals, we arrange the flight schedule for rescued dogs. Some of our rescued dogs are being fostered in GTA. Please check their locations on profiles.

Chenny's Happy Tails Rescue Canada is a not-for-profit group(Corporate name: 12023318 CANADA FOUNDATION) registered in Canada, based in Toronto, Canada.

We are against the slaughter and consumption of dogs in Korea.
In Korea, there are many dogs that are kept in overcrowded cages in dog-meat facilities. They are sent to the market after being tortured to death. Although the consumption of dog meat is increasingly controversial and the vast majority of younger generations do not believe in dog meat, there are still many dogs that need to be rescued from farms and streets on which they have been abandoned/mistreated by humans.

We are committed to finding forever homes for dogs in Canada.
Chenny's Happy Tails Korea rescues and rehabilitates dogs to make them ready to be adopted.
Chenny's Happy Tails Canada works on finding the best adopter for each dog who can provide them a forever loving home and reliable care.
